BMGT4023S Research Paper 1

Academic Year 2023/2024

You are required to examine the application of the various theoretical perspectives presented on the MSc programme to one's own workplace experience, particularly in relation to organisational behaviour and strategic management and business policy. This research paper provides for blending of theory and practice contents of the MSc programme with the collective workplace experiences of participants. To this end you will be expected to contribute critical reflection on your workplace experiences along with collaborative interpretation of such experiences in both classroom and study group settings. The module provides an insight into the research methods used to navigate the research process in the disciplines mentioned above. To fulfil the requirements for the module, you are required to undertake and complete two assignments as follows:a. Proposal b. Literature Review c. academic paper review.

Learning Outcomes:

On completing this module, students should be able to
a. Critically evaluate and review academic literature on a business topic,
b. Demonstrate a practical and reflective understanding of selected functional and general management activities.
c. Evaluate ways in which the selected business themes and topics are useful to practicing managers, bearing in mind the business context and setting.
d. Critically evaluate research papers and demonstrate effective analytical and report writing skills
